Grab your Phillips, it's... The Latest from The Screwdriver List! I am trying to setup a RAID=0 (stripping) configuration on my Abit KT7/RAID system. I was not getting the RAID to setup with each of the two HDDs plugged into separate connectors as masters. A friend of mine told me to change the jumpers to cable select. I did, and the RAID immediately set up just the way it should recognizing both drives as masters on their respective (primary/secondary) connectors. But now, I have another problem. I am trying to load the O/S. The Win ME froze when initializing setup, and that happens when you have a Nvidia graphic card minus the ME required driver. I don't have an OS as yet, so I can't install the latest driver. It's a catch-22. Win 98 also cannot get into setup. And Win 95 keeps trying to initialize, without moving forward. The C: drive cannot be read, and asking it for a "dir" gets the message: Invalid media type reading drive C:. It asks if it should abort, retry, etc. If I try to format the C: drive, it states: Insufficient memory to load system files. Format terminated. Does someone have experience with this kind of problem? I have a 1 Gig Athlon Thunderbird, and 256 MB memory. Enough to tackle a NASA problem. If only I could load up an OS. Please help. Thanks.
